Arugula

Arugula, also known as rocket, is a leafy green vegetable known for its peppery flavor and high nutritional value. It is rich in vitamins, minerals, and antioxidants, making it a popular choice in salads and culinary dishes.

Arugula is high in antioxidants, which help combat oxidative stress and reduce the risk of chronic diseases.
Rich in vitamin K, arugula supports bone health and plays a crucial role in blood clotting.
